For the 2025 school year, there are 3 public schools serving 1,069 students in 99324, WA (there are , serving 466 private students). 70% of all K-12 students in 99324, WA are educated in public schools (compared to the WA state average of 90%).
The top ranked public schools in 99324, WA are Davis Elementary School and John Sager Middle School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public schools in zipcode 99324 have an average math proficiency score of 38% (versus the Washington public school average of 41%), and reading proficiency score of 44% (versus the 53% statewide average). Schools in 99324, WA have an average ranking of 5/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Washington public schools.
Minority enrollment is 50%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Washington public school average of 52% (majority Hispanic).
